This repository provides native TensorFlow execution in backend JavaScript applications under the Node.js runtime, accelerated by the TensorFlow C binary under the hood. It provides the same API as [TensorFlow.js](https://js.tensorflow.org/api/latest/).

import {FlipLeftRight, FlipLeftRightInputs, KernelConfig, tensor1d, util} from '@tensorflow/tfjs-core';
import {createTensorsTypeOpAttr, NodeJSKernelBackend} from '../nodejs_kernel_backend';
export const flipLeftRightConfig: KernelConfig = {
kernelName: FlipLeftRight,
backendName: 'tensorflow',
kernelFunc({inputs, backend}) {
const nodeBackend = backend as NodeJSKernelBackend;
const {image} = inputs as FlipLeftRightInputs;
const opAttrs = [
createTensorsTypeOpAttr('Tidx', 'int32'),
createTensorsTypeOpAttr('T', image.dtype),
];
const axes = util.parseAxisParam([2], image.shape);
const axisTensor = tensor1d(axes, 'int32');
const res =
nodeBackend.executeSingleOutput(
'ReverseV2', opAttrs, [image, axisTensor]);
axisTensor.dispose();
return res;
}
};
